Georgia - Livestock Net Production Per Capita Index
Since 2014, Georgia Livestock Net Production Per Capita Index was down by 0.7% year on year. At $78.24 PPP = 2004–2006 in 2019, the country was number 183 comparing other countries in Livestock Net Production Per Capita Index. Georgia is overtaken by Oman, which was ranked number 182 with $78.64 PPP = 2004–2006 and is followed by Chad at $77.92 PPP = 2004–2006. Bahrain topped the ranking with $250.16 PPP = 2004–2006 in 2019, that is a growth of 2.3% versus 2018. Myanmar, Malawi and Brunei resp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Myanmar recorded the best 5 years average growth at +2.2% per year, while Antigua and Barbuda witnessed the worst performance at -17.6% per year.
